Diameter of the rivet to be provided on a 20 mm. thick boiler plate will be ______________ mm?

Correct answer: D. 40

  • A. 10
  • B. 20
  • C. 30
  • D. 40

Explanation

Using the standard boiler-joint rule that the rivet diameter is approximately twice the plate thickness, d = 2(20) = 40 mm. This gives option d.
